| TTCB – Results Central Zonal Council 40-over Limited Overs / Ramsingh’s Sports World Twenty20 Series April 16th 2009 Singh hits century lifts Esperanza to double titles Ali Roadstars Esperanza Sports captured the Central Zonal Council 40-over limited overs title, with a comprehensive 140-run-win against Balmain United on Saturday at the Exchange Recreation Ground in Couva. It was the first of the coveted double for the Esperanza team. Esperanza got an unbeaten century (118) from Guyanese Garvin Singh in a total of 298 for four off the allotted overs. Singh smashed 12 fours and three sixes in his knock of 118 and received good support from Rudy Ramdeen who scored 85. In response, Balmain folded for a disappointing 158 in 32 overs, with only Rixon Pancham (33), Bobby Sookoo (31) and Ramdeen Bidhesi (24) offering resistance. Top bowlers for Esperanza was Rossi Ramsaroop with three for 41. Also among the wickets were Maxie De Jong with two for 18 and the impressive Gareth Ali with two for 22. Singh captured the ‘Man of the Match’ award, while Esperanza pocketed the winning prize of $4,500 and a trophy, while Balmain collected $3,000. On Monday at the Edinburgh Ground, Esperanza defeated D&D McBean Sports by 39 runs in the final of the Ramsingh’s Twenty20 Series. Esperanza batted first and were dismissed for 126, to which McBean replied with 87. Esperanza’s Deodath Arjune who made an important 24 and bagged two for 18, earned the ‘Man of the Match’ award. For their winning effort, Esperanza took home $4,000, while McBean got $3,000 for reaching the final. Summarised Scores — Central Zonal Limited Overs AT EXCHANGE: Ali Roadstars Esperanza Sports 298-4 (40 overs) (Garvin Singh 118 not out, Rudy Ramdeen 85) v Balmain United 158 all out (32) (Rixon Pancham 33, Bobby Sookoo 31, Ramdeen Bidhesi 24, Rossi Ramsaroop 3-41, Maxie De Jong 2-18, Gareth Ali 2-22). Esperanza won by 140 runs. Garvin Singh (MoM). Summarised Scores — Ramsingh’s Sports World Twenty20 Series AT EDINBURGH: Ali Roadstars Esperanza Sports 126 all out (20 overs) (Garvin Singh 30, Lyndon Luke 19, Deodath Arjune 24, Surti Rajnath 2-27, Sookram Jagmohan 2-23, Navin Chatoor 2-25, Nicholas Ramdhan 2-30) v D&D McBean Sports 87 all out (18.2) (Steve Bachan 18, Dave Ramdhan 16, Jimmy Rampersad 3-17, Errol Lewis 2-18, Deodath Arjune 2-18). Esperanza won by 39 runs. Deodath Arjune (MoM). |
